Product Description:

The 175Z0131 is a frequency converter produced by Danfoss within the VLT 5000 Frequency Converters series. It is intended to modulate the speed of three-phase induction motors, allowing plant controllers to match fan, pump, or conveyor output to process demands while maintaining torque at low speeds. By converting a fixed mains frequency into a variable output frequency, the unit supports energy savings and precise flow regulation in industrial automation cells.

This model accepts a three-phase 380–500 V supply, so it can be wired directly to common industrial feeders without step-up or step-down transformers. In applications that permit a 110 percent overload, the converter is rated for 2.2 kW of continuous motor power. Heavy-duty cycles that reach 160 percent torque limit the usable rating to 1.5 kW. A compact IP20 enclosure allows installation inside ventilated control cabinets while guarding against accidental contact with live parts. Conducted emissions are suppressed by the integrated Class A1/Class B filter, which helps the installation comply with electromagnetic compatibility requirements in light-industrial areas. The converter is supplied in a standard configuration without a preinstalled application option, allowing machine-specific functions to be connected separately when required.

The internal logic is managed by a process control card that provides proportional, integral, and derivative control for closed-loop speed or pressure regulation. A supplied front-mounted display shows output frequency, current, and fault codes for local diagnostics. The unit uses uncoated circuit boards, which are suitable for cabinets where humidity and airborne contaminants are adequately controlled. The converter has no fieldbus option, so integration relies on analog references or hardwired input and output channels provided by the host PLC. These connections allow the controller to issue operating commands and receive status signals without requiring a dedicated industrial communication network.
